CourseDetails
โข Global Financial Systems: Understanding the interconnectedness of global financial systems and markets.
โข Financial Crisis: Causes and Consequences: An in-depth analysis of the causes and consequences of financial crises, including the 2008 global financial crisis.
โข Financial Regulation and Oversight: Exploring the role of financial regulators and the importance of effective financial oversight.
โข Risk Management in Financial Institutions: Best practices for managing risk in financial institutions, including credit, market, and operational risk.
โข Monetary Policy and Financial Stability: The role of monetary policy in promoting financial stability and preventing financial crises.
โข Financial Crisis Management Strategies: Tools and strategies for managing financial crises, including crisis resolution and bank restructuring.
โข International Cooperation in Financial Crisis Management: The importance of international cooperation in managing financial crises and preventing contagion.
โข Financial Crisis Communication and Media Relations: Best practices for communicating with the public and the media during a financial crisis.
โข Case Studies in International Financial Crisis Management: In-depth analysis of real-world financial crises, including their causes, consequences, and management strategies.
